8 votos

¿Cómo puedo hacer que el proceso de reconocimiento facial continúe?

Ahora mismo, si voy a la sección Personas de photos.app, un mensaje dice que ha analizado x fotos, mientras que el resto y Las fotos se analizarán cuando no esté utilizando la aplicación y mi Mac esté conectado a una fuente de alimentación.

¿Qué significa exactamente "no usar la aplicación"? ¿Debe estar abierta, pero no la aplicación en primer plano? ¿Oculta? ¿Cerrada? ¿Puede ejecutarse mientras el Mac está en reposo? (He visto en los registros fotoanálisisd pidiendo que se ejecute en la prioridad Mantenimiento).

Lo pregunto porque no está haciendo el progreso que esperaría y me cuesta entender exactamente cómo debo dejarlo.

4voto

tilo Puntos 101

Según esta entrada del blog Photos.app debe cerrarse, ya que photoanalysisd se suspende mientras la aplicación está abierta. La explicación dada en la aplicación Fotos es definitivamente demasiado vaga. Aún así, tengo el mismo problema de no experimentar el progreso que hubiera esperado (4.900 / 12.000 en siete días).

2voto

Bartley Puntos 139

Yo también me encontré con este problema. Sin embargo, tras seguir las instrucciones para salir de la aplicación Fotos y permanecer conectado, sólo vi un pequeño progreso. SIN EMBARGO, pronto descubrí que también tenía Fotos configurado como mi salvapantallas, por lo tanto, por lo que puedo entender, esto viola la regla utilizada por el sistema operativo para procesar las fotos cuando no se inicia sesión en Fotos. He cambiado mi salvapantallas para usar las imágenes de National Geographic y ahora procesa las fotos mucho más rápido.

1voto

Daniel Puntos 11

Encontré que al establecer las fotos como elementos ocultos de inicio de sesión y luego reiniciar el mac desencadenó photoanalysisd en acción.

Mi configuración:

  • Mac Mini 2014 MacOS 10.15.2
  • La biblioteca de fotos está en una unidad de fusión externa (SSD+HHD)
  • 40000 fotos y vídeos (~300GB)
  • poner el disco duro en reposo cuando sea posible apagarlo

Después de eso encuentro el PID en el monitor de actividad y renice photoanalysisd y photolibraryd. No hago clic en la aplicación de fotos después de reiniciar. Ahora photoanalysisd es ~130% uso de la cpu.

1voto

Ali Nadalizadeh Puntos 126

Técnicamente hablando, "Fotos" utiliza PhotoAnalysis.framework y este marco se ejecuta en segundo plano si CoreDuet programador lo permite.

CoreDuet permite que el fotoanálisis se ejecute si:

  1. El portátil está conectado a la fuente de alimentación
  2. Tener más del 30% de batería
  3. La aplicación Fotos no funciona
  4. Nadie está trabajando con el ordenador

Así que si quieres que photoanalysisd funcione, debes evitar que tu portátil entre en reposo, conéctalo a la fuente de alimentación, cierra la aplicación de fotos y no toques tu ordenador y deja que procese tus fotos cuando esté en reposo.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X